提交时间:2024-10-07 17:09:20
运行 ID: 33336
#include <cstdio> #include <iostream> #include <algorithm> using namespace std; typedef long long LL; int n, a[100010]; int cnt[20]; int main() { scanf("%d", &n); for (int i = 1; i <= n; i++) { scanf("%d", &a[i]); cnt[a[i] % 3]++; } int ans = cnt[0]; ans += min(cnt[1], cnt[2]); ans += (max(cnt[1], cnt[2]) - min(cnt[1], cnt[2])) / 3; cout << ans << endl; return 0; }